iOS6开发基础教程:高清英文PDF指南

"这是一本关于iOS6开发的基础教程,提供高清英文PDF版本。"
本书旨在引导初学者进入iOS应用开发的世界,特别针对iOS6这一版本进行深入讲解。内容涵盖从入门到进阶的各种主题,适合对iOS开发感兴趣的读者。书中通过清晰的章节划分,逐步介绍了iOS开发的核心概念和技术。
作者和审阅者在业界具有丰富的经验,确保了教程的专业性和准确性。书中的章节包括:
1. 第一章“欢迎来到丛林”:介绍iOS开发环境的搭建,Xcode的使用,以及iOS开发的基本概念。
2. 第二章“安抚图腾神灵”:讲解Objective-C语言基础,Apple的开发工具和编程模型。
3. 第三章“处理基本交互”:涉及UI元素的创建和用户交互事件的响应,如按钮、文本框等。
4. 第四章“更多用户界面乐趣”:深入讨论更复杂的UI组件,如图像视图、滑块、开关等。
5. 第五章“自动旋转和自适应大小”:探讨如何让应用适配不同设备的方向和屏幕尺寸。
6. 第六章“多视图应用程序”:介绍如何在应用中切换和管理多个视图。
7. 第七章“标签栏和选择器”:讲解如何使用TabBar和PickerView来提升用户体验。
8. 第八章“表格视图简介”:深入学习UITableView的使用,包括数据源和代理方法。
9. 第九章“导航控制器和表格视图”:结合NavigationController来构建层级结构的界面。
10. 第十章“故事板”:介绍使用Storyboard进行界面设计和逻辑连接的方法。
11. 第十一章“iPad开发注意事项”:专门讨论针对iPad设备的特定设计和优化。
12. 第十二章“应用设置和UserDefaults”:学习存储用户偏好和简单数据的方法。
13. 第十三章“基本数据持久化”:讲解SQLite数据库和文件系统的使用,实现数据的长期存储。
14. 第十四章“嘿!上云!”:介绍Apple的iCloud服务,以及如何在应用中集成云同步功能。
15. 第十五章“大中央调度,后台处理与你”:探讨GrandCentralDispatch和后台任务处理,提高应用性能。
16. 第十六章“用Quartz和OpenGL绘图”:深入图形绘制技术,包括2D和3D渲染。
17. 第十七章“轻触、触摸和手势”:讲解触摸事件处理和手势识别,增强用户交互体验。
18. 第十八章“我在哪里?利用CoreLocation和MapKit定位”:使用GPS和其他定位技术,集成地图功能。
19. 第十九章“哇!陀螺仪和加速度计”:介绍利用硬件传感器实现动态感应和运动检测。
每一章都包含了详细的教学内容,通过实例和实践项目帮助读者掌握每个主题。此外,书中的索引和目录(Contents at a Glance)提供了快速查找和跳转的功能,方便读者查阅和学习。
这本书是iOS6开发者入门和进阶的理想资源,无论你是新手还是有一定经验的开发者,都能从中受益匪浅,掌握iOS应用开发的关键技能。
相关推荐








joying1
- 粉丝: 0

最新资源
- MetaTrader 5趋势指标:ViniNI_Trend脚本功能解析
- 掌握C#.NET多线程编程:实例详解与互斥技巧
- 新版数学手册:第5、6版精要
- 源码工具布局测试方法及newDOM压缩技术
- JLINK ARM V415e驱动程序安装指南
- 上海市最新矢量边界数据,2018年影像地图精确修剪
- MATLAB模拟立方体状态控制序列开发
- 实现淡入淡出效果的轮播图教程
- ColorMomentum_AMA交易系统 - MetaTrader 5EA实战应用
- 整数转换工具源码分享:快速实现自定义整数转换
- C#考勤管理系统源码解析与应用
- 树形菜单的VC文件夹选择效果源码解析
- C#开发的图书管理系统功能概述
- Winform打印模板设计技术分享
- C#实现普里姆算法构建最小生成树教程
- 基于Java实现的五子棋游戏:功能丰富,课设完美呈现